It is a universally accepted truth that children usually feel unwell in the middle of the night when you are bone tired, when most pharmacies are closed and no doctor is available. It is therefore very important to have some essential medicines like fever reducers, pain killers and antiseptic creams in stock at home. It is equally important to know their correct dosage according to your child's age and weight so that the medicine can be administered at once. In case of life threatening or chronic problems like asthma or juvenile diabetes, all medicines should be kept in a separate pouch so that you are not searching drawers or turning out cupboards while crucial minutes tick by.
Fever, chest congestions, flu, cold, ear and throat infections and asthma are common ailments that can make life very difficult for our children.
Taking care of the child
A sick child usually becomes very irritable and cranky. It can take every ounce of your effort and patience to keep him calm and make sure that he takes the proper medicines and nutrition to help him on the road to recovery.
When young children succumb to fever or cold, the initial 24 hours can be the most trying and energy draining. Blocked and stuffy nose make it impossible for a child to breathe normally or get any sleep. Breathing through the mouth causes dryness. Diarrhea and vomiting also cause the body to become dehydrated so it is very important that the lost fluids are replenished. Give small quantities of diluted orange juice and plenty of water to keep the child hydrated.
It is a good idea to place a steamer or humidifier in the child's room. A small quantity of Vicks vaporub can also be placed inside the humidifier so that the vapours spread in the air. This makes the air moist which relieves congestion and coughs and helps the child breathe more easily.
A sick child needs a lot of comfort and reassurances. Their illness can quickly take a toll on them making them tearful and fatigued. Some children feel comforted with their favourite toys tucked up in the bed with them but your presence and attention is always the main source of comfort for them.
Diet and nutrition
This is probably not the best of times to discuss merits of eating vegetables. While the child's body is busy fighting illness, it will lack appetite which returns only when he is on the road to recovery.
